the long version
This book celebrates the character and richness of the English landscape. It contains contributions from 27 writers who care deeply about England and have a special affinity with one particular area, along with more than 100 descriptions of every corner of England, showing how each is special in its scenery, wildlfie, environment and history. Filled with loving photographs and essays--by David Bellamy, Christopher Lloyd, Richard Mabey, Marina Warner, and others--this illustrated tour of the English countryside takes readers on a vivid tour through one of the world's most beautiful landscapes. 10,000 first printing.
